Output 91d851ee61d34de65d2bded2f2a50f2a6b4532cc53cd7601f94bfbb150fc26bb: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af35f640f1b6296152911a0d0816dda019ed6d7a OP_EQUALVERIFY OP_CHECKSIG
address
1GyRtuq5ZukFLnT9ft2VYKdvHyxepB7pKd
transaction
91d851ee61d34de65d2bded2f2a50f2a6b4532cc53cd7601f94bfbb150fc26bb
confirmations
316069
spent
true